Lexical Definition

‎עֶרְוָה‎ ʻervâh (er-vaw') nakedness H:N-F
from ‎עָרָה‎

nakedness, shame, unclean(-ness).

1) nakedness, nudity, shame, pudenda
1a) pudenda (implying shameful exposure)
1b) nakedness of a thing, indecency, improper behaviour
1c) exposed, undefended (fig.)

Brown-Driver-Briggs

‎עֶרְוָה‎54 noun feminine nakedness, pudenda; — absolute ‎׳‎‎ע‎ Exod 28:42; Lev 18:6 usually construct ‎עֶרְוַת‎ Gen 9:22 +, suffix ‎עֶרְוָ˜תְךָ‎ Exod 20:23 (Ginsb), Lev 18:10 ‎עֶרְוָתֵךְ‎ Isa 47:3 +; ‎ת֯וֺ‎ Lev 20:17, ‎תָ֯הּ‎ Lev 18:7 +; suffix 3 feminine plural ‎עֶרְוָתָן‎ vLev 18:9 vLev 18:10

1. pudenda, of man ‎׳‎‎רָאָה ע‎ implying shameful exposure Gen 9:22; Gen 9:23 (J); mostly of woman: figurative of Jerusalem (with ‎רָאָה‎) Lam 1:3; Ezek 16:37 usually with ‎׃ נלה‎ literal ‎׳‎‎תִּגָּלֶה ע‎ i.e. be exposed to view Exod 20:23 (Ginsb; van d. H. vExod 20:26 E), so, as shameful punishment, figurative of Egypt Isa 20:4 (gloss according to Du Che Di-Kit), Babylonian Isa 47:3, of Jerusalem Ezek 16:37; Ezek 23:10; Ezek 23:29 (‎עֶרְוַת זְנוּנַיִךְ‎; all three object of active verb); chiefly euphemism for cohabitation, ‎׳‎‎גִּלָּה ע‎ Lev 18:6 + (see ‎גלה‎ Pi`el 1 a; figurative of Jerusalem (verb passive) Ezek 16:36 ‎׳‎‎רָאָה ע‎ in same meaning Lev 20:17 (twice in verse) (H; of both sexes); ‎׳‎‎ע‎ also Lev 18:8; Lev 18:10; Lev 18:16 (H); ‎׳‎‎כִּסָּה ע‎ cover nakedness Gen 9:23 (J), Exod 28:42 (P; ‎׳‎‎בְּשַׂר ע‎), Hos 2:11* (figurative of Israel), Ezek 16:8 (of Jerusalem); reviling words are ‎אִמֶּ֑ךָ‎ ‎׳‎‎לְבשֶׁת ע‎ 1Sam 20:30 (compare DoughtyArab. Deserta i. 269).

2. ‎עֶרְוַת דָּבָר‎ nakedness of a thing, i.e. probably indecency, improper behaviour Deut 23:15*; Deut 24:1 (see Dr).

3. figurative ‎הָאָרֶץ‎ ‎׳‎‎ע‎ Gen 42:9; Gen 42:12 (E), i.e. its exposed, undefended parts (Arabic ).
